The efficiency of quantum tomography based on photon detection

We propose a general methodology for efficient statistical reconstruction of a quantum state through collection and analysis of photon counting statistics. Our approach includes both strict quantitative criteria for adequacy and completeness of the statistical inverse problem, as well as a simple and reliable method for evaluating errors in the reconstructed state and approximation of a quantum state by means of the reduced finite-dimensional model.
